Quarterly Planning Note — Revised Sales-Commission Scheme
To: The Board

From Q2, commissions shift from flat-rate to margin-weighted payouts under the Stellane model. Accelerators apply above 110% of quota; clawbacks extend to six months. Pilot results in the Ravensmere division showed a 9% margin lift. Rollout requires board ratification this cycle. The related growth assumptions are detailed in the confidential note below.

management briefing: Istaelix Group is in early talks to buy Sorysax Logistics for about $496.2 million. The Kasox launch date is October 3, and nothing goes to the press before then. Legal wants the Norokax Foods term sheet withdrawn before April 25.

Ticket: Vault lockout blocking Hollybranch catalogue import. While loading the Westmere Library's catalogue into Shelfwright, the import worker hit the credentials vault too many times in a row (retry loop bug, already patched) and the vault locked itself. The import is now stalled at about 60%, and the cataloguing team is understandably antsy. Could you review and approve the unlock? Everything's logged if you want to audit the attempts first. Once approved, the vault accepts the recovery passphrase listed below.

unlock words, yawig-kagef: gordor-holvan-ulaael-pramir-ulaiel-tamdor

Subject: Fixed: websocket reconnect storm in Pondera

Hey all — quick heads up for whoever inherits this later. Pondera clients were hammering the gateway after a dropped connection because our backoff reset to zero on every handshake failure. Classic. We now persist the backoff state across attempts and cap retries at ten before surfacing an error to the user. Tested against the Marwick staging cluster with simulated flaky networks; reconnect storms are gone. Shipping in tonight's release. The build token is right below for reference.

session token of tajef-bageg = htk21_5d90d574934f3ccae6437

Subject: Thornback build moving to hermetic toolchain tonight

Heads up for on-call: the Thornback service switches to the Kilnworks hermetic build system at 22:00. All toolchains are now fetched from the sealed cache, so network flakes during compile should disappear. If a build fails, do not fall back to the legacy script — page the build team instead. The cutover build is recorded below.

trace token, fafog-kageg: htk4_98e6